WebThe line of flags in 1874 had become a U-shape in 1882. The flag that moved the farthest away is the portion where the glacier moved the fastest. The glacier thus moved the fastest in the center of the glacier i.e. its central axis. 18.2. WebOct 18, 2012 · This animation shows how ice is naturally transported from interior topographic divides to the coast via glaciers. The colors represent the speed of ice flow, with areas in red and purple flowing the fastest at rates of kilometers per year. The vectors indicate the direction of flow.
